A Rocky Return

Koepka's return to the PGA Tour has been a mixed bag, to say the least. His performance in the Farmers Insurance Open was underwhelming, and missing the cut in the WM Phoenix Open soon after raised questions. However, a glimmer of hope emerged at the Cognizant Classic, where he seemed to find his rhythm. What's intriguing here is the psychological aspect. Returning to a familiar setting, Koepka had to navigate the challenges of readjustment, and his initial struggles highlight the mental fortitude required in professional sports.

The Putter Switch: A Mechanical Revelation

The switch to a Spider putter is a significant detail in Koepka's narrative. He attributes this change to seeking more consistency, a common quest in golf. The 17th Green: A Personal Nemesis

The iconic 17th green at TPC Sawgrass has been a thorn in Koepka's side. His struggles here are well-documented, with a staggering over-par record. What many don't realize is that such personal nemeses are common in golf. Every golfer has that one hole, shot, or course that seems to defy their skills. It's a fascinating psychological aspect of the game, where mental barriers can be as challenging as physical obstacles.
